What Happened?

Five Below Inc. elevated its full-year financial outlook, sparking an increase of more than 8% for its shares in postmarket trading on Wednesday. The retail company attributed this positive momentum to its ongoing store expansion strategy and the strong traction its budget-friendly inventory has gained with younger consumer groups like Gen Alpha and Gen Z.
